Tar roof installation services involve replacing or installing a new layer of protective material on the roof of a property. This process typically includes removing the existing roof, preparing the surface, and carefully laying down new tar paper or asphalt-based roofing materials. The goal is to create a durable, waterproof barrier that shields the building from weather elements such as rain, snow, and wind. Experienced contractors ensure that the installation is performed correctly to maximize the lifespan of the roof and prevent future issues.
This service helps address common problems like leaks, water damage, and roof deterioration caused by aging or weather exposure. Over time, tar roofs can develop cracks, blisters, or areas of wear that compromise their integrity. Replacing a worn or damaged tar roof can prevent more extensive water intrusion, mold growth, and structural damage. Additionally, a properly installed tar roof can improve energy efficiency by providing better insulation and reducing heating or cooling costs.
Properties that often require tar roof installation include commercial buildings, warehouses, garages, and some residential structures with flat or low-slope roofs. These roofs are favored for their affordability and ease of maintenance, especially in commercial settings. Property owners in areas prone to heavy rain or snow may also opt for tar roofing to ensure reliable protection. The overview below groups typical Tar Roof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Antioch, TN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or tar roof repairs in the Antioch area range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or sealing j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ed.
Partial Replacement - Replacing a section of a tar roof us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more involved partial replacements are less common but can reach up to $4,500 depending on the size and complexity of the area.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ete tar roof replacements for residential properties generally range from $4,500 to $8,000. Most projects fall into the middle of this range, while larger or more complex installations can exceed $10,000.
Complex or Commercial Projects - Larger, more complex tar roof projects for commercial buildings or extensive renovations can cost $10,000 or more. These are less frequent but represent the high end of typical project costs in the local area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a tar roof? A tar roof can provide a durable, weather-resistant covering for flat or low-slope roofs, offering effective protection against water intrusion and environmental elements when properly installed by experienced contractors.
How do local contractors ensure proper tar roof installation? They follow industry best practices, use quality materials, and tailor the installation process to the specific needs of each building to ensure a secure and long-lasting roof.
What types of buildings are suitable for tar roof installation? Tar roofs are commonly used on commercial structures, apartment complexes, and some residential flat-roofed buildings where a reliable waterproof membrane is needed.
What maintenance is required after a tar roof is installed? Regular inspections for damage or cracks, keeping the roof clear of debris, and addressing repairs promptly can help extend the lifespan of a tar roof.
